Why can't I see any old or new Services?

Please check the following:

  1. Be sure AtYourService is installed in your Applications folder.
  2. Be sure you've logged out and logged back in after making a change.
  3. Be sure to check the entire hierarchy for your Service's name. If the name of your Service doesn't begin with "AtYourService/", the menu item will appear elsewhere in the Services menu.
Why are all of my services greyed out? I can't select any of them!

This is always caused by one of two things:

  1. Be sure you've selected some text before looking in the menu.
  2. The application you are using may not be Services aware. Tell the company that makes the software to support Text Services!
How do I sort or reorder the items in the Services menu?

Mac OS X always sorts the Services menu alphabetically. AtYourService has no control over the appearance of this menu. A request to fix this has been sent to Apple.

Why do some applications display a nice hierarchy in the Services menu while some display the full names with slash characters in them?

This is a bug in Mac OS X. Specifically, Cocoa applications do not display many levels of hierarchy while Carbon applications do. A request to fix this has been sent to Apple.

Why Command-Shift combinations don't work sometimes?

There are the following possibilities why this isn't working:

  1. If you are typing the key combination before doing anything else in the application, this won't work. A request to fix this has been sent to Apple.
  2. There may be a conflict with the a key combination in the hosting application. The application's key combination always take precedence.
  3. The application may not be trapping the key combination for some other reason and not sending it on to OS X.
